I have them on all my pipes.

Makes them much more comfortable to hold in the teeth and protects them from bite marks.

And a lighter pipe with a rubber pipe tip is still more comfortable than a light pipe without.

Quality pipes have stems that are still able to be damaged by teeth. My Dunhill tanshell is a quality pipe by anyones standards, but has a vulcanite stem that is plenty soft. Pipe tip keeps it looking good.
